Key Considerations When Choosing a Healthcare Program

1. Assess Your Career Goals

The first step in choosing the right healthcare program is determining your long-term career goals. Are you interested in direct patient care, administrative work, or healthcare technology? Understanding your career aspirations will help narrow down your options.

  • Direct Patient Care: If you're passionate about providing hands-on care, consider programs like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) or Phlebotomy Certification.

  • Administrative Roles: For those who enjoy organizing and managing operations, programs like Medical Office Administration or Healthcare Management might be ideal.

  • Specialized Healthcare Careers: If you're interested in fields like radiology or surgical technology, look for programs that offer specialized training in those areas.

How to Choose the Best Healthcare Program for Your Needs

1. Research Different Programs and Specializations

Healthcare is a broad industry with many specialized fields. It’s essential to research different programs that align with your career goals. Here are some of the most common healthcare programs and the roles they prepare you for:

  •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A): CNAs work directly with patients in hospitals, nursing homes, and long-term care facilities. They assist with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and feeding patients.

  • Phlebotomy Technician: Phlebotomists draw blood for medical tests, donations, and transfusions.

  • CPR and First Aid Certification: Essential for healthcare workers, as well as for people working in community centers, schools, and public safety.

  • Healthcare Administration: If you're interested in managing healthcare facilities, this program teaches the fundamentals of healthcare management, budgeting, and compliance.

  • Medical Assistant (MA): MAs work alongside physicians and nurses to perform clinical and administrative tasks such as taking vital signs, handling patient records, and preparing exam rooms.

2. Understand the Program Length and Flexibility

The length of the program is an important factor in your decision-making process. Some healthcare programs, like CPR Certification or Phlebotomy, can be completed in a few weeks, while others, like Nursing Assistant or Healthcare Administration, may take several months or years.
